According to the National Taxpayer Advocate, in a blistering criticism of Form 1023-EZ, 37 percent of a representative sample of Form 1023-EZ applicants whose applications were approved by the IRS were not, as a matter of law, 501(c)(3) organizations (i.e., they didn’t qualify and could run into major problems if they ever get audited).
